Modern microscope labeling goes beyond mere magnification. Today’s labeling systems, often incorporating fluorescent markers, biochemical probes, and AI-assisted pattern recognition, deliver real-time, multi-dimensional data about every specimen examined. What’s shocking? These labels don’t just show structure—they unveil dynamic processes, cellular interactions, chemical compositions, and even behavioral trends within samples.
Companies specializing in high-tech microscopy now embed smart labels that react to environmental changes, detect pathogens, or highlight molecular pathways selectively. For example, fluorescent dyes attached at the molecular level can distinguish live from dead cells, identify specific proteins, or trace nutrient diffusion—transforming static slide views into living narratives.
What These Labels Actually Reveal
- Microbial Life in Action
Labels that bind to mitochondrial activity or DNA reveal microbial communities alive and thriving—or struggling under stress. This level of detail helps scientists track infections, understand bacterial behavior, and monitor antibiotic responses with unprecedented accuracy.

Environmental Domains
In environmental samples, advanced labeling identifies pollutants at microgram levels, tracks heavy metals’ distribution in soil, or detects microplastics with molecular specificity. This precision enables faster remediation and deeper ecological insights. -
Material Science Breakthroughs
For materials researchers, specialized microscopes with hyper-specific labels clarify crystallographic structures, detect microscopic defects, or monitor how engineered materials degrade over time—critical for developing next-gen nanotech and biomaterials. -
Medical Diagnostics Demystified
Early disease detection hinges on seeing the invisible. Microscope labeling now identifies cancerous cells markers or neurodegenerative protein aggregations before symptoms appear, significantly improving diagnostic windows and treatment outcomes.
